Actor/director Rob Reiner and his wife were found dead at their Los Angeles home, victims of an apparent homicide. Reiner’s son Nick, 32, has been taken into custody. Reiner is best-known for playing Archie Bunker’s son-in-law Mike Stivic AKA The Meathead on ’70s sitcom All in the Family.
